I’ve got what i think is an unaddressed counter issue for my folding super ikonta. Advance knob works great but the counter reset button seems to be non functioning. I cannot reset the counter embedded inside the advancing knob to start the roll at the proper spot. Looks like the little dot is always red. Any suggestions on how to fix? Obviously there isn’t enough winding from 0 unless the frame lock is disengaged. I’m loosing my first two frames at least.
